    I will be gone for about 10 days during the 2nd weekend of june.

    If she drops when I'm gone, I'm going to tell my petsitter to leave her alone, maybe mist in the cage, and let her incubate them. The person who agreed several months ago to watch the animals (hopefully she'll still do it, I've been out sick from work and haven't been able to contact her for a month :( ) isn't a herper, so I don't want to put added stress on everything and have her try to deal with an upset IJCP momma. Then I'll put the eggs in the incubator when I get home.

    This is my first season with breeding carpet pythons and the first time I expect to see snake eggs. So I dunno how much is pretty gravid with carpet pythons... and the first season I've seen an ovulation. She's been hanging out on the heat all the time and hiding, which isn't normal behavior for her. She is vocal now about being touched or being handled right now as well.
